Core Differences Between Blender and Adobe Tools

Blender is a comprehensive 3D creation suite. It covers modeling, sculpting, texturing, rigging, animation, and rendering, all in one package. Adobe's flagship tools focus on different parts of a creative stack: Photoshop and Illustrator excel at 2D image editing and vector design; After Effects and Premiere handle motion graphics and video; Substance 3D offers material creation and texturing that can be used across applications. The two ecosystems can overlap, but each has a different philosophy and workflow. Blender emphasizes an all-in-one pipeline with a fast, iterative approach and a strong emphasis on open formats; Adobe emphasizes deep specialization, cross‑suite integration, and a subscription-based economy that targets professionals with multi‑product workflows. For beginners, Blender's learning curve can feel steeper initially, but there are extensive tutorials and community forums. For professionals, the decision often comes down to whether the project requires Adobe's specific tools, licensing models, and the existing production pipeline. Licensing, Cost, and Access

Blender operates under a permissive open source license, which means you can download, use, modify, and share it freely for personal or commercial projects with no licensing fees and no paid upgrades. Adobe tools, by contrast, are distributed on a subscription basis as part of Creative Cloud, which means ongoing costs as long as you need access. This difference matters for personal projects, student work, or hobbyist prototyping where budget predictability is important. Interoperability: Moving Between Blender and Adobe Apps

Interchange between Blender and Adobe tools is facilitated by common file formats such as OBJ, FBX, and GLTF. You can export 3D assets from Blender and import them into Substance 3D, Photoshop, or After Effects for material creation or compositing. Conversely, textures and flat designs from Adobe apps can be brought into Blender as image textures or reference assets. The workflow is often best when you model and animate in Blender, texture in Substance 3D, and finalize visuals in a compositor or video tool. Maintaining consistent color management and a linear workflow helps preserve realism across tools. With thoughtful file organization and version control, you can integrate Blender into an Adobe‑influenced pipeline without friction.

Getting Started with Blender for Beginners

Begin with the basics: download Blender from blender.org, install the latest stable release, and familiarize yourself with the default scene. A great first project is a simple low‑poly object to learn navigation, modifiers, and the concept of a node-based material. Enable essential add-ons such as LoopTools for geometry, Cell Fracture for experimentation, and the Node Wrangler for faster shading work. Set up a clean workspace, customize hotkeys, and bookmark reliable tutorials from BlendHowTo and other reputable sources. Practice a small project weekly to build confidence, then gradually introduce more complex tasks like UV mapping, lighting, and rendering with Cycles or Eevee. The key is steady, hands‑on practice and using free resources to build foundational skills.

Common Myths and Realities

A common myth is that Blender cannot produce realistic renders. In reality, Blender’s Cycles and Eevee render engines are capable of high‑fidelity results with proper lighting, textures, and materials. Another misconception is that Blender is only for game assets; it is widely used for film, architecture, product visualization, and art. Some assume you must pay for powerful plugins to succeed; in truth, many excellent add-ons are free or community‑maintained. Finally, some people think Blender lacks professional support compared to proprietary software; while official paid support may be limited, the active community, extensive documentation, and third‑party tutorials provide robust, timely guidance.
